Web17 feb. 2024 · Drones are 'haploid', having been reared from an unfertilized egg. As a result, a drone has only half the chromosomes of a worker bee or queen bee - the drone has 16 chromosomes, workers and queens have …

Web23 sep. 2024 · In honey bees, the male is haploid while the female is diploid. Haplodiploidy occurs in some insects like bees, ants and wasps. Male insects are haploid because they develop partheno-genetically from unfertilized eggs. The phenomenon is called arehenotoky. Meiosis does not occur during the formation of sperms.

WebHow fast can honey bees move? The worker honey bee moves at a speed of 13-18 mph (20-28 kmph) while foraging and reaching a food source. It can move at a slower pace while returning to the hive with all the food collected at a speed of 11 mph (17 kmph). Honey bee swarms can fly at a speed of 3.2-4.5 mph (5.1-7.2 kmph).
